Dee and I had reservations for the morning boat tour so we had to be down at the river by 9:30. It was a beautiful day with temps in the mid 70s, sunny, with a slight breeze. We boarded the boat and were off on the river by 10:05 with a full compliment of passengers.

We headed up river then turned right into the oxbow where we had been the day before in the canoe. In the morning there are a lot more birds because the boat traffic hasn't disturbed them.

Again we saw lots of variety s of birds with an occasional alligator and turtle. The plants lining the shore are a floating mass of vegetation, a favorite of the manatee, also providing cover and a food source for smaller water birds. There are also nests in this floating mass that offer the birds protection from some of their predators.

Coming off the boat there was a large bush just covered with flowers and the butterflies couldn't resist. There were 7 or 8 butterflies and I was able to catch an imagine of one on a lower branch. They are tiger swallowtail butterflies.
